As part of our ongoing commitment to uplift, upskill and raise our community, our annual Liberty Promenade #NextGeneration competition, held in November 2021, saw five local Mitchells Plain schools winning their share of the R60 000 prize money.

The talent competition – a community favourite – served as a platform for learners to share their message around leadership, through various artforms, including song, dance, poetry and rap. Learners also referenced influential figures, such as Winnie Mandela, Mother Theresa and Mahatma Gandhi in their performances.

Local Mitchells Plain schools Eastville Primary, Eisleben Road Primary, Lentegeur Secondary, Spine Road High and Yellowwood Primary each won R10 000. Yellowwood Primary also garnered the most votes online and walked away with the Community Choice award and an additional R10 000.

Cash prizes will be used to improve the winning schools’ facilities or to purchase much-needed educational resources, such as classroom renovations, textbooks, computer upgrades, projectors, books, upgrades to their school fields and refurbishments of tables and chairs.
